The Big 10 adding Maryland and Rutgers will not be good in the long run. You aren't going to be able to force cable on people for much longer. More and more people are cord cutting. All those people in Baltimore, D.C., and NJ/NYC aren't going to be paying attention to Maryland and Rutgers.

Don't follow the Big 10's lead of adding programs because they are located near population centers.
